Mục lục:
Video: Arduino: Housefire Minegame: 5 bước (có hình ảnh)
2025 Tác giả: John Day | [email protected]. Sửa đổi lần cuối: 2025-01-13 06:58
Hướng dẫn
Dưới đây tôi đã cung cấp các yêu cầu và giải thích để thực hiện dự án này. Tôi dành rất nhiều thời gian cho mã. Bạn có thể tùy ý tạo môi trường của ngôi nhà theo sở thích của riêng mình (nghĩ đến cây cối, con đường hoặc một số ngôi nhà khác).
Các phần thiết yếu mà tôi đã sử dụng:
- Arduino Uno
- Bảng bánh mì
- 4 đèn LED
- 2 LDR
- 11 dây cáp
- Điện trở 4 x 220
- Điện trở 2 x 10k
Bước 1: Chuẩn bị Arduino
Ở đây bạn sẽ thấy hình ảnh của quá trình cài đặt. Tệp có mã cũng được bao gồm ở đây.
Bước 2: Tạo ngôi nhà
Tôi đã sử dụng bìa cứng cho ngôi nhà. Tôi bắt đầu bằng cách đo arduino, để có đủ không gian trong nhà. Sau đó tôi ghép mặt tiền của ngôi nhà lại với nhau. Bạn có thể tạo mặt trước như bạn muốn, nhưng điều cần thiết là phải có cửa sổ để cuối cùng đặt các LDR ở phía trước nó.
Bây giờ mái nhà đang đến. Tôi dán cái này lại với nhau bằng các bộ phận khác nhau (xem các hình trên).
Bước 3: Tô màu Ngôi nhà
Bây giờ chúng ta đã đi được nửa chặng đường. Phần khác sẽ là tô màu cho ngôi nhà và làm người lính cứu hỏa (điều này dĩ nhiên có thể là thứ khác). Tôi đã sử dụng khăn giấy cho các cửa sổ. Tô màu ngôi nhà tôi đã làm bằng bút dạ (Promarkers). Đảm bảo rằng bề mặt của lính cứu hỏa đủ lớn để tạo ra bóng khi lính cứu hỏa đứng trước LDR.
Bước 4: Phong trào lính cứu hỏa
Cuối cùng, bạn cần một cái gì đó để di chuyển lính cứu hỏa. Những gì tôi đã sử dụng là một sợi dây thun quấn quanh hai bánh xe đồng. Các bánh xe bằng đồng có thể được vặn trên đế gỗ.
Bước 5: Kết hợp các bộ phận lại với nhau
Và ở đó bạn đi!
Ở trên bạn thấy sản phẩm cuối cùng. Bạn có thể điều chỉnh độ nhạy sáng trong mã đối với ánh sáng tại vị trí của bạn (theo ldrstatus2).